Higher octane indicates a fuel's resistance to knock or pre-ignition. It is essential for high-compression or turbocharged engines. However, "Extra Quality" also refers to the additive package. A fuel can have high octane but lack the powerful detergents needed for cleaning. BP Ultimate provides both a high octane rating (typically 97-98 RON) and a superior cleaning formula.
